Replacing uPVC Window Handles

It is easy to change the handles on windows made of upvc. It is important to make sure that the new handle is fitted into the spindle cutout of the window mechanism.

If you follow the steps below the handle of any cockspur will fit in most windows. The most important factor is the step height of the handle.

What to Look For

Over time, uPVC handles on many windows in the UK can start to show signs of wear and front Door handle Repair wear and tear. The window handle can become loose or difficult-to-operate when this happens. This is a fairly simple job that is achievable by anyone who is comfortable with basic hand tools.

The first step is to ensure that the handle is securely attached to the frame of the window and in its open position. The next step is to find the fixing pins or screws that keep the handle in the position it is in. They are typically located on the inside of the handle. They can be removed using an screwdriver or pliers.

When the handle has become loose It is best to gently pull it away from its hinges. It is then necessary to find a replacement handle with the same design and size. This can be done on the internet or in an area DIY store, and should take about five minutes with a screwdriver.

One important factor to consider when replacing the uPVC window handle is the step height. This is the distance between the handle's base and where it sits within the frame of the window. This is a common measurement and you should confirm the height of the step prior to ordering an replacement handle.

Depending on the kind of handle you choose There are various sizes to choose from. Inline handles are offered for uPVC window with lug centres of 31mm while cockspur handles have centers of lugs of 43mm. Tilt-and front door handle Repair turn handles are typically found on uPVC windows. They have a special design which allows the window be slid down to let in air, and then turned to fully open the window.

The most common cause of breakage in uPVC handles is that they crack internally instead of breaking away from the base section. This can make them hard to open and therefore it is crucial to ensure that the replacement handle you buy has the same length of spindle that your current one.

Remove the Old Handle

Incorrectly fitted or damaged window handles could cause double-glazed windows to open or close in a way that isn't correct and may cause them to become stuck. There are many reasons, such as general wear and tear or corrosion of the handle. In these cases it is crucial to replace the upvc window handle as promptly as you can to avoid further damage or loss of function.

When replacing the handles on windows made of upvc and handles, it is important to remove the old handles from the window. Start by removing the screw by the handle while it is in the closed position. This should reveal another screw that once removed, you are able to begin to remove the handle. You can make the process easier by using an electric screwdriver.

You should also be aware that screws may be hidden under plastic caps. It is best to remove the covers with the help of a Stanley knife. Once the old handle is removed, you should then take a look at the square cut out on the base of the handle to make sure that the new window lock handles will work with it. It is important to measure the spindle length on the handle that was used and compare it to the dimensions of the window mechanism spindle cutout.

The various types of window handles made of upvc are: Espag handles, which feature a central screw that can be turned left or right; Cranked handles which have two screws and are used on tilt and turn windows made of upvc and Spade handles which have an arm with a flat surface and can be put on either side of the window. It is easy to replace the handle when you've found one that is suitable. Just screw it into place, and make sure the spindle is properly inserted into the lock mechanism. After that the handle should be secured to the window frame and the replacement window handles made of upvc must be secure.

Take a measurement of the Spindle

If you're replacing a Upvc window handle that has come off, it's due to the spindle that holds it in place has become damaged or loose. In some instances, it can be fixed with screws or pins to tighten it. In other cases it will need to be replaced entirely. There are a few different kinds of window handles made of upvc. There are three kinds of handles: inline espagnolette, cockspur, and tilt-and-turn. Each kind has a distinct procedure for installing and removing the handle.

Before buying a replacement handle it is essential to know the dimensions of the existing one. This will ensure that the handle will fit the window in a proper manner and be the correct size. All handles are calibrated according to industry standards, making it easy to find the correct size.

To measure the handle's size you must turn the window to the open position. You should be able see the size of the pin or screw that holds the handle. Use a ruler or tape measure to determine how long the spindle is. Once you know the length of your spindle, it is possible to purchase a replacement of exactly the same size.

The step height of a upvc window handle is also important to consider when purchasing replacements. The step height is measured from the base to the point at which the door handle repairs is placed on the frame. This is usually around 21mm or 9mm in aluminum and uPVC. To make sure that the new handle is suitable the gap, drop something in the gap to see how far it extends before it meets an obstruction.

Cockspur handles usually have different backset heights, based on the style of window they are installed in. Inline Espag handles have the standard height of 43mm centre to centre (2 fixing points). Cockspur handles however, have different backset heights depending on the shape of the window they're in. This is because they have a spur which extends from their handle and is locked onto a cockspur wedge hitting plate.
